Frequently asked questions

About SMITHVILLE J H
How large is SMITHVILLE J H?
SMITHVILLE J H enrolls approximately 412 students in grades 06-08.
What age range does SMITHVILLE J H serve?
SMITHVILLE J H serves students from grade 06 through grade 08.
How many teachers does SMITHVILLE J H have?
SMITHVILLE J H employs 29 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 14.1:1.
How diverse is SMITHVILLE J H?
SMITHVILLE J H reports a student body of 47% White, 42% Hispanic, 6% Black, 1% Asian, 4% Two or more.
Who oversees SMITHVILLE J H?
SMITHVILLE J H is overseen by SMITHVILLE ISD in Bastrop County.
